Chelsea boss Carlo Ancelotti was happy to give Nathaniel Chalobah and Josh McEachran their chance against Crystal Palace yesterday.
The pair are back at Chelsea after helping England win the U17 European Championships this summer.
"[Chalobah was born in] 1994, so young, and for him it is important to stay with us for some time. His team will be the youth team for next season," Ancelotti explained to chelseafc.com. "[McEachran] has to improve, he has fantastic skill, is in the national Under 17 team and has his future.
"I think three, four or five players can be with us in the squad next season. We have a lot of young players ready to play in our team."
